Every place deserves an inspiring interior that shares the story of its location, history or conveys an experience. Discovering these unique stories and translating them into interior concepts is what Marlous and her designers at MW Studio’s do best. Their mission is to focus on the behaviour and needs of people in every design.

The hospitality industry and leisure market are their specialty. In addition, Marlous and her team are often asked to help create workplaces that are ‘non-standard’ and spaces where atmosphere and sustainability are important. Their portfolio includes projects such as shops, offices, schools and museums, for example, the café at the Tax and Customs Museum on Parklaan in Rotterdam, as pictured. Here, the team converted a sleek business setting into a warm living room atmosphere.
